Primary Responsibilities:

Responsible for training delivery drivers on a day-to-day basis on all aspects of the delivery driver job duties
Utilizes all company training guides, manuals, checklists, and processes to ensure compliance with company policies, practices, safety, and DOT regulations

Responsibilities may include, but not limited to:

  • Performs preferred work method observations and provides verbal and written feedback on driver trainees' performance including suggested development actions
  • May run routes per business needs
  • Functions as a team member within the department and organization, as required, and performs any duty assigned to best serve the company
  • Exhibits str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Utilizes all systems and tools effectively, i.e., computer, software systems
  • Working knowledge of Department of Transportation (DOT) regulations (i.e., hours of service, pre-trip/post-trip, etc) and company safety policies and practices
  • Ensures all policies are followed
  • Delivers hands-on training that allows for maximum transfer of knowledge while ensuring customer needs, service times, labor and transportation costs are met and within guidelines
  • Provides ongoing and timely feedback to assigned driver trainees and supervisory staff
  • Feedback includes positive reinforcement and constructive corrective actions
  • Understands and exhibits strong customer service skills
  • Works with new driver hires and experienced drivers in classroom and/or field settings to prepare them for a successful professional driver career
  • May supplement PFG Driver Training Manual with local programs specific to the location, products and reports used in that market
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.

Required Qualifications:

  • 3-5 years of route delivery driver experience specifically in foodservice distribution industry with in-depth knowledge of DOT regulations.
  • High school diploma/GED or state approved equivalent
  • Experience with computerized fleet operations management systems
  • Valid CDL A
  • Meet all State licensing and/or certification requirements (where applicable)
  • Must be 21 years of age
  • Meet all State licensing and/or certification requirements (where applicable)
  • Clean Motor Vehicle Report (MVR) for past 3 years
  • Pass post offer drug test and criminal background check
  • Pass road test
  • Valid current DOT Health Card and/or able to secure new DOT Health Card
  • Able to hand-lift and utilize two-wheeler, lift gate and/or other equipment to move and/or stack product cases/freight of varying size and weight throughout shift; product generally ranges from between 10-35 pounds and up to between approximately 60 and 90 pounds, depending on the location
